Is engineered wood flooring waterproof?

Not quite—but it’s far more resistant to moisture than solid wood! Engineered wood flooring is designed with a stable, multi-layer construction, which makes it less prone to warping and expanding when exposed to humidity or small spills. However, because the top layer is real wood, excess water or standing moisture can still cause damage over time.

How to Protect Engineered Wood Flooring from Moisture:


Wipe up spills immediately – Even though engineered wood is more stable than solid wood, prolonged exposure to water can cause damage.
Choose a lacquered finish – A lacquered surface provides extra protection against spills, making it a great option for kitchens or hallways.
Avoid installing in bathrooms – Areas with high moisture and frequent splashes aren’t ideal for engineered wood.
Use rugs or mats – Placing mats at entrances or in high-traffic areas helps prevent water and dirt from being tracked in.

If you love the natural beauty of wood but need a fully waterproof option, luxury vinyl tiles (LVT) could be the perfect alternative. However, with the right care, engineered wood flooring can be a durable, stylish, and long-lasting choice for your home!
